    In European Union there's this A1 class of motorcycles, 125cc and maximum 11 kW (roughly 15 hp), for which (unlike cars or bigger motorcycles) one can get the licence in the age of 16. People usually ride them two years before upgrading to a bigger bike (or more commonly, buying a car, or moving to a city to study and switching the bus and the bicycle). Adult beginners almost always start with something bigger (see class "A2" if interested). And while this model was not sold in Europe when this video was made, it is now, and I think it's entirely possible Kawasaki thought that market from the day one.
    I mean a great chunk of your target audience is literal teenagers, this might explain the aggressive looks on a cute little bike...
